Get personalized picks →About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ars: Michael struggles with dreams of dark waters and an unknown ancient evil resting beneath the cold waves. Are these simply dreams or are they a premonition of things to come?

Frequently asked about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ars
- Does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ars run on Steam Deck?
-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ars is rated Playable on Steam Deck — it runs, but expect some manual adjustments (control remapping, text size, or graphics settings) for the best experience.
- Is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ars free to play?
- Yes —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ars is a free-to-play title on Steam. You can install and play it without buying anything, though some games include optional in-app purchases.
- What games are most similar to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ars?
- Based on Steam play patterns and shared genres/tags, the games most often recommended alongside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ars are 44 The Jail, Care, Start Running.
- Who developed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ars?
- Arkhangel: The House of the Seven Stars was developed by Winter Night Games and published by ZQ SFX LLC.
